Whether your ambition is to help athletes smash world records, or improve the quality of life for recovering patients, we can give you the tools to achieve it.
Our Sport and Exercise Science degree equips you with the skills to enhance athletic performance and health. Youll study biomechanics, physiology, psychology, and nutrition, developing key competencies in academic writing, research methods, and data analysis. Youll also have the opportunity to spend an extra year expanding your horizons, working on a placement in industry.

Entry Requirements
UCAS Tariff
Access to HE Diploma
Pass Access to HE Diploma in a science subject with a minimum of 112 UCAS Tariff points.
Pearson BTEC Level 3 National Extended Diploma (first teaching from September 2016)
DMM
BTEC in one of the following subjects: Applied Science, Sport and Exercise Science or Sport.
A level
Grades BBC or equivalent, to include minimum grade C in one of the following subjects: Physical Education, Psychology, Biology, Human Biology, Chemistry or Physics (with a Pass in Practical Assessment).
